Where to stay in Audubon-Downriver

Downtown Spokane
The stunning river views and popular shops are just a few highlights of Downtown Spokane. Make a stop by Bing Crosby Theater or Knitting Factory while you're exploring the area.

South Hill
One reason travelers love spending time in South Hill is the stunning river views, and Manito Park is a top place to visit.

North Spokane
You might appreciate the shopping and restaurants in North Spokane, and if you're interested in seeing more of the area, NorthTown Mall and The Podium are just a few notable stops.

Riverside
While visiting Riverside, you might make a stop by sights like First Interstate Center for the Arts and Riverfront Park.

East Central
If you're looking for some top things to see and do in East Central and surrounding area, you can visit First Interstate Center for the Arts and Spokane County Fair and Expo Center.
